🥂macerate (mǎsīlèit)

verb
/ˈmæsəˌreɪt/
浸泡 (jìnpào)

含义

to soften or break up something, especially food, by soaking in liquid
含义翻译
通过浸泡在液体中,使某物变软或分解,尤其是食物
tōngguò jìnpào zài yètǐ zhōng, shǐ mǒu wù biàn ruǎn huò fēn jiě, yóuqí shì shíwù

例句

The chef macerated the fruit in wine before serving.

厨师在上菜前将水果浸泡在葡萄酒中。
Chúshī zài shàngcài qián jiāng shuǐguǒ jìnpào zài pútáojiǔ zhōng.

同义词

soak, steep, soften, dissolve

反义词

dry, harden

搭配词

macerate fruit, macerate herbs, macerate vegetables
